US redeploys South Korea defence systems to Middle East despite Seoul's objections
18/03/2026-21:00 18/03/2026-21:20 חדשות قناة Al Jazeera דיווח
The United States has redeployed artillery and anti-missile systems from South Korea to the Middle East without Seoul's approval, straining the decades-old alliance. President Donald Trump is also pressing South Korea and Japan to send warships to the Strait of Hormuz, a request Seoul's ruling party says may violate domestic law. The mounting demands are fuelling debate in South Korea over the alliance's value and reviving calls for the country to acquire its own nuclear weapons, whilst concern grows over being drawn into conflicts with China and the Middle East.
